Create search_index_0 to search_index_15 tables and shard each index by
account id. MySQL has no ability to pre-filter fulltext indexes by
another field so this is the best bet for improving performance.
Each fulltest index internally creates 11 sub tables (see
https://dev.mysql.com/doc/refman/8.4/en/innodb-fulltext-index.html) so
actually we have 192 tables in total here.
The search_index table name is generated dynamically based on the
account_id.
Add a single search_index table for full-text search of cards and
comments.
For the search there is a full-text index on the title and content
columns. The board_ids is also included in the table and accessible
board ids are pre-loaded and included in the search query. This allows
us to filter out inaccessible records before joining with other tables.
Right now the search is just using boolean search. This would give us
a bunch of syntax options
(see https://dev.mysql.com/doc/refman/8.4/en/fulltext-boolean.html)
except the search query filters those out.
I've removed the searchable_by method for now - everything is built
on the assumption that there's a single search index table and all data
must fit into it.
Queries are written in SQL, we don't have a SearchIndex ActiveRecord
model. That's because we'll likely want to shard the table and it will
be simpler to just keep with the raw SQL for that.
There's no stemming, highlighting or snippet extraction yet - we are
dumping the full description in the search results.
Data can be reindexed with the search:reindex rake task.
